Emerging Trends in the Business Industry
Several significant trends are currently shaping the business landscape:
- Digital Transformation: Firms are rapidly incorporating digital technologies to boost efficiency, increase customer satisfaction, and encourage innovation. Technologies like AI, ML, and cloud solutions are transforming business operations.
- Sustainability Initiatives: Growing environmental awareness is leading businesses to adopt sustainable practices. Organizations are concentrating on minimizing their ecological impact through reducing carbon output, recycling initiatives, and renewable energy investments.
- Remote Work Adaptations: The pandemic has expedited the transition to remote work, prompting businesses to explore blended work models that integrate flexibility and productivity.
- Focus on Customer Experience: Companies are placing more emphasis on customer experience by utilizing data analytics to comprehend consumer behavior and tailor their services to fit customer needs.
Obstacles in the Business Industry
While the industry offers numerous opportunities, it also encounters several challenges:
- Regulatory Challenges: Managing a complex web of regulations is important for businesses. Adhering to local, national, and international laws is crucial for ensuring operational integrity.
- Economic Instability: Business performance can be swayed by economic volatility. Factors such as inflation, changes in consumer habits, and geopolitical events can create instability.
- Talent Management: Recruiting and retaining top talent remains a critical hurdle. As the industry evolves, investment in workforce training is important for meeting new skill requirements.
- Technological Advances: Rapid technology evolution can disrupt established business frameworks. Keeping pace with technological trends is necessary for competitiveness.

Growth Opportunities in the Business Industry
In light of these challenges, the business industry is filled with opportunities:
- Growth in Emerging Markets: Developing regions offer substantial growth prospects. Companies can extend their market presence by tapping into these areas, which often boast a burgeoning middle class with increasing consumer demands.
- Research and Development: Focusing on R&D can lead to breakthrough developments. Companies that invest in research are better positioned to meet shifting consumer needs and strengthen competitiveness.
- Strategic Collaborations: Forming partnerships can enhance capabilities and drive growth. Collaborations offer joint resources and access to new markets.
- Diversity and Inclusion: Valuing diverse perspectives enhances innovation. Businesses that prioritize diversity are typically more adaptable and better prepared for success.
